A captivating drama of love, revolution and what it means to grow up in a divided world.
“Why love, if losing hurts so much?”
Sephy and Callum sit together on a beach. They are in love.
It is forbidden.
Sephy is a Cross and Callum is a Nought. Between Noughts and Crosses there are racial and social divides.
A segregated society teeters on a volatile knife edge. As violence breaks out, Sephy and Callum draw closer, but this is a romance that will lead them into terrible danger.
This gripping Romeo and Juliet story is by acclaimed writer Malorie Blackman, adapted by Sabrina Mahfouz and directed by Esther Richardson.
Finalist for Best Show for Children and Young People, UK Theatre Awards.
